TEA TOWEL CHALLENGE

I was inspired by a WI friend who had made a lovely bag using 3 tea towels.  This made me think 'what else  could I make with  them ?'

So I bought a load of pretty tea towels (you need the smooth ones - not the loopy towling type) I paid about £3 for three.  This set had particularly pretty edgings and trims including a 'Made with Love' label and heart button, which I used to great effect.  The tea towels are a really good quality strong cotton.
The pink polka-dot tea towel is from another set.  I used the two long sides to make all the handles for my set of bags and purses.
 The first thing I made was a small tote bag for the side of my wheeelchair, measuring approx  22 x 24 cm.  I used some of the pink polka-dot for the outside of this bag. The bag is lined   and interlined with some wadding. I used the  the flowery tea towel for the lining and also for a pocket on the front to keep my phone handy. The bag has a single handle (12") from side to side, and Velcro fastening.   I finished it off with the 'Made with Love' label and heart button.
The next thing I made was a treat bag for Bailey (the dog!) This uses the white tea towel with the flowery border, and the pink polkadot for lining and tab handles.  The tabs have Velcro on the end to form  loops to go over a bar or belt.
Finally I made a camera case and a zipped purse from the flowery fabric, lined with white.
So that is four little bags I've made from 3 tea towels, and there is still some fabric left! Watch this space to see how I use that!
